Q • Can I use this with gasoline-powered trimmers? A • Only if your model has a 5 mm output shaft. Most gas trimmers use 10 mm or 25 mm heads.
Q • Will it scratch paving or concrete? A • The bristles clean surface joints without gouging solid materials—just keep the head flat while in use.
Q • How long does it last? A • Longevity depends on use intensity. Most users get 1–2 seasons before wire length shortens significantly.
Q • Do I need protection gear? A • Absolutely. Always wear a face shield, gloves, long pants, and sleeves to prevent injury from flying debris.
Q • Can the wires be replaced or sharpened? A • No need. The twisted strands self-sharpen during use. Replace the whole head once worn under 15 mm.
